The A6C0N1E from Mitsubishi is a specialized 37-pin D-Sub connector designed mainly for interfacing with PLC high-density I/O modules. This female connector features a D-Subminiature interface for enhanced connectivity in various applications.

| Manufacturer | Mitsubishi |
|---|---|
| Product Type | 37-pin D-Sub Connector |
| Product Line | Other |
| Part Number | A6C0N1E |
| Connector Type | D-Subminiature Interface |
| Pin Count | 37-pin |
| Gender | Female |
| Primary Application | PLC High-Density I/O Module Interface |
| Wire Gauge Range | 28 AWG to 22 AWG |
| Housing Material | Polybutylene Terephthalate |
| Color | Black |
| Min. Operating Temperature | -20 °C |
| Max. Operating Temperature | 80 °C |
| Min. Storage Temperature | -25 °C |
| Max. Storage Temperature | 75 °C |
Designed for demanding applications, the Mitsubishi A6C0N1E is a 37-pin D-Sub connector that serves a critical function in PLC high-density I/O modules. Its female design allows for secure connections, enhancing the reliability of electronic systems.
The D-Subminiature interface facilitates efficient data transmission and is ideal for various connectivity tasks. The connector is constructed from polybutylene terephthalate, offering a combination of strength and resilience in diverse environments. Its black housing blends well in installations while providing a professional appearance.
This connector supports a wire gauge range from 28 AWG to 22 AWG, accommodating a variety of cable sizes. Thermal parameters are well within useful ranges, with an operating temperature minimum of -20 °C and a maximum of 80 °C. For storage, it can tolerate temperatures as low as -25 °C and as high as 75 °C, ensuring functionality in both extreme temperatures.
